Looks to me like this deck has two issues. The first is that it's 64 cards, not 60. The second is a lack of synergy.

You don't have many cards that give you a payoff for having Wizards or Spiders. You have mill cards, but not enough of them to actually win that way. You have Wizards and Spiders, but the two tribes don't really do anything to boost each other. Because of this, your cards accomplish less than they ought to.

I suggest dropping the mill and picking a narrower theme with more mechanical support. Something Delirium-based might work. If you're willing to go beyond Standard, there's plenty of good Wizard support out there. (Here's a deck of mine that might give you some ideas.) Or you could try some kind of green-black graveyard-Spider deck with Spider Spawning.
